Male C. longicollis removed (with permit) from a Perth reserve. Have obscured the location but uploading to inform people to keep an eye out in case any more are around. I ended up removing a male and female, under the instruction of DPIRD. They are very similar in appearance to our native species, but are slightly larger, especially their shell which is far rounder and more pronounced than C. oblonga. Other defining characteristics are yellow plastron with black defined grooves, slightly thinner/shorter neck, smaller head, and longer claws.

One of at least two that are at Hyde park as a result of Atlantic Seafood Market in Northbridge selling live eels and Buddhists practicing Life Release not understanding the ecological impact.
A 2015 study on the turtle population conducted by UWA accidentally trapped one in the nets they had set up to catch the turtles for a population count. No successful recruitment has been noted at Hyde Park in over 15 years, with the city of Vincent willing to spend $5000 on a 2022 study again by UWA but unwilling to address the probable predation of turtle hatchlings by these eels. We know eggs are hatching, I’ve assisted numerous hatchlings in making it to the water since 2018, and it has taken me over 5 months to gain evidence of the eels, yet the city of Vincent says it’s a job for the department of fisheries, who say it’s not their job at all.
